    1) Product Images from "Moderate hyperglycemia suppresses melanoma metastasis to liver"

    Article Title: Moderate hyperglycemia suppresses melanoma metastasis to liver

    Journal: Experimental Animals

    doi: 10.1538/expanim.22-0078

    Effects of moderate hyperglycemia on the expression of TNFα , Cxcl10 , and macrophage markers in the liver. (A) TNFα expression. (B) Cxcl10 expression. (C–F) macrophage markers. Every gene expression intensity was normalized to that of GAPDH . Bars are mean ± SEM, n=3 ( TNFα ), n=6 ( Cxcl10 , F4/80 , CD68 , CD86 , CD206 ). (G) Protein band of CD86 and GAPDH of Wild and GKKO mice liver samples (a) and their intensity profiles analyzed using ImageJ (b). Blue dotted line: Wild, red dotted line: GKKO.

    Article Snippet: The PVDF membrane was then blocked in TBS-T (Tris-buffered saline (25 mM Tris, pH 7.4, 150 mM NaCl) containing 1 (v/v)% Tween 20) solution containing 5 (w/v)% skim milk at 25°C for 30 min. Then the PVDF membrane was probed with primary antibodies against mouse B7-2 (CD86) (1:500, sc-28347; Santa Cruz Biotechnology, Dallas, TX, USA), and GAPDH (1:1,000, sc-32233; Santa Cruz Biotechnology) in a 5% skim milk TBS-T solution at 25°C for 3 h. The membrane was further incubated with secondary antibody (anti-mouse immunoglobulin conjugated to alkaline phosphatase, Promega, Madison, WI, USA) in TBS-T at 25°C for 1 h. Finally, membranes were incubated with Western Blue Stabilized Substrate (Promega) for alkaline phosphatase at 25°C for 10 min.
